The Essential Guide to Residential Glaziers: What You Need to KnowWhen it pertains to home enhancement and renovations, the function of a residential glazier is frequently overlooked. Nevertheless, glaziers play a crucial part in guaranteeing that your windows, doors, and other glass installations not just look great but also function efficiently. This blog site post intends to elucidate the function of residential glaziers, the types of services they supply, and what property owners should think about when hiring a glazier.What is a Residential Glazier?A residential glazier specializes in the installation, repair, and replacement of glass in homes. Their knowledge encompasses numerous applications, consisting of windows, doors, mirrors, and shower screens. Residential glaziers have a deep understanding of glass types, installation techniques, and security requirements, making them important for any job that involves glasswork.Common Services Offered by Residential GlaziersResidential glaziers offer a variety of services targeted at enhancing the looks and functionality of homes. Here are some typical services they provide:ServiceDescriptionWindow InstallationSetting up new windows, consisting of double-glazed and energy-efficient alternatives.Window RepairRepairing broken or split window panes to bring back functionality and security.Shower ScreensSetting up custom glass shower screens for restrooms, consisting of frameless designs.MirrorsCustom mirror installation, consisting of wall mirrors, ornamental mirrors, and vanity mirrors.Glass Door InstallationInstalling and fixing glass doors, consisting of moving and bi-fold doors.Glass BalustradesInstalling glass balustrades for staircases, verandas, and outside areas for safety.Tinting and CoatingApplying window films to minimize UV exposure and improve personal privacy.Why Hire a Professional Residential Glazier?While DIY may appear appealing, the intricacies associated with glass installation and repair require the abilities of a professional.
